Catalog Description:
Origins and basic postulates of quantum mechanics, solutions to single-particle problems, angular momentum and hydrogenic wave functions, matrix methods, perturbation theory, variational methods. Covers quantum mechanics at greater depth than CHEM 455. No more than 3 credits from the following may count toward graduation requirements: CHEM 453, CHEM 455, CHEM 475. Prerequisite: either CHEM 153, CHEM 162, or CHEM 165; MATH 126 or MATH 136; and PHYS 116 or PHYS 123. Offered: A.
